Raonic vs Bublik: Clash of the Titans at Rotterdam Court

Published on 02/13/2024 4:30 p.m. by Jérémy Ernou | Modified on 02/14/2024 at 05:35

It’s going to hit hard this Wednesday on the Rotterdam court with a big confrontation to come between two hitters, Milos Raonic and Alexander Bublik, with a place in the quarter-finals at stake. Winner of the Montpellier tournament 10 days ago, the Kazakh is full of confidence and plays his game to perfection. Relying on a high quality of service which allows him to make the difference (another 13 aces made during the first round against Borna Coric), Alexander Bublik seems to have reached a milestone at the start of the season with also a semi-final in Adelaide to start the season. Certainly, the poor performance at the Australian Open (elimination in the first round) remains a big stone in the Kazakh’s shoes, but the disappointment seems to have passed, and his victory in the South of France is a positive sign. Impressive on Tuesday when he entered the competition in the Netherlands against the Croatian Borna Coric (6-3, 6-4), Alexander Bublik will have to face a player just as powerful or even more powerful than him, Milos Raonic. The Canadian, who returned last summer after more than 2 years off, still wants to play, having expressed doubts about the rest of his career a few months ago. The North American giant’s physique still remains a problem, like his abandonment in the first round in Melbourne, but his power and his shoulder are still there to serve. Winner of the Dutchman Jesper De Jong in the first round with a great quality of service (22 aces), Milos Raonic remains a reference in this sector. And to beat a player in great shape, you will have to repeat this kind of performance in this sector!
